溫馨提示×

SQLite數據源在DataX中的配置

小樊
124
2024-09-11 11:08:53
欄目: 云計算

在DataX中,SQLite數據源的配置主要包括以下幾個部分:

  1. 數據庫連接信息:需要提供SQLite數據庫的文件路徑。
  2. 表名:需要指定要讀取或寫入的表名。
  3. 列名:需要指定要讀取或寫入的列名。
  4. 分頁查詢:對于大數據量的表,可以使用分頁查詢來提高讀取速度。
  5. 數據過濾:可以通過WHERE子句對數據進行過濾。

以下是一個SQLite數據源的配置示例:

{
    "name": "sqlite",
    "parameter": {
        "connection": [
            {
                "jdbcUrl": ["jdbc:sqlite://path/to/your/sqlite.db"],
                "table": ["your_table_name"]
            }
        ],
        "username": "",
        "password": "",
        "column": ["col1", "col2", "col3"],
        "where": "1 = 1",
        "splitPk": "col1",
        "fetchSize": 1000,
        "querySql": [],
        "preSql": [],
        "postSql": []
    }
}

其中,jdbcUrl 是SQLite數據庫的文件路徑,table 是要讀取或寫入的表名,column 是要讀取或寫入的列名,where 是數據過濾條件,splitPk 是用于分頁查詢的主鍵列名,fetchSize 是每次查詢返回的記錄數。querySql、preSqlpostSql 分別用于自定義查詢語句、前置SQL語句和后置SQL語句。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女